Description:

OUR CLIENT IS A LARGE MANAGEMENT CONSULTANCY LOOKING FOR PROJECT MANAGERS WITH STRONG APPLICATION/DIGITAL TOOL EXPERIENCE TO ASSIST THEIR CLIENTS WITH IMPLEMENTING NEW TOOLS, OR TRANSITIONING FROM OLD TO NEW TOOLS, TO HELP REDUCE COST.

The ideal candidate will have experience working across the full project lifecycle, as well as strong agile, implementation, and transformation or change experience. You will be used to working in a complex technical environment and be strong at problem solving.

Responsibilities:

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Project manage the full lifecycle of a digital application upgrade.
  • Implement digital applications/tools or ERP Upgrades for government clients.
  • Assisting clients with implementing new tech tools or transitioning them from older tools to newer tools.
  • Helping companies who have merged to transition, migrate, or integrate tech.
  • Manage projects that consist of cross-disciplinary teams and ensure delivery to meet agreed timescales, quality, processes, and procedures.
  • Liaising with stakeholders and SMEs to aid the development and delivery of requirements.
  • Assist with the creation of business cases if required.
  • Interface with project teams to ensure solutions are delivered across the client business.
